Automated Design and Integration of Asset Administration Shells in Components of Industry 4.0
Jakub Arm1, Tomas Benesl1, Petr Marcon1
1Faculty of Electrical Engineering and Communication, Brno University of Technology, 616 00 Brno, Czech Republic.
This study explores the Asset Administration Shell (AAS), a key Industry 4.0 concept for digital manufacturing components. It details AAS creation and integration, verifying distributed manufacturing management through a virtual assembly line case study.

Background:
- Industry 4.0 emphasizes digital transformation in manufacturing.
- The Asset Administration Shell (AAS) is a core concept for digitalizing manufacturing components.
- Standardized data envelopes are crucial for interoperability in smart factories.
Purpose of the Study:
- To analyze the structure, components, and sub-models of the Asset Administration Shell (AAS).
- To evaluate methods for creating AAS, including automated generation.
- To demonstrate the integration and verification of AAS in a virtual assembly line for distributed manufacturing management.
Main Methods:
- Detailed analysis of AAS structure, sub-models, and communication protocols (OPC UA, MQTT).
- Case study involving a virtual assembly line with integrated AAS.
- Assessment of manual AAS creation versus framework-based automated generation using a configuration wizard.
- Modeling of a discrete event system for Industry 4.0 solution application.
Main Results:
- Comprehensive analysis of AAS formation for individual components.
- Successful integration of AAS into a virtual assembly line, enabling verification of distributed manufacturing management.
- Demonstration of automated AAS generation via a configuration wizard.
- Validation of Industry 4.0 principles through a discrete event system model.
Conclusions:
- The Asset Administration Shell (AAS) provides a standardized framework for digitalizing manufacturing components in Industry 4.0.
- Automated generation methods can streamline AAS creation.
- Integrating AAS into virtual environments effectively verifies distributed manufacturing management capabilities.
